I need your help.
Here are the specifics: I won the auction. The seller attempted to send the item BUT the package went to another state ( California) based on the tracking number the seller provided and is on its way back. I finally reached a live person at USPS and was told that my address was incorrect on the package. My mailing address is correctly on file with eBay. The seller accidentally or intentionally mislabelled my address.
I notified eBay that I had not received the package yet. I did not request a refund or cancellation, only I had not received the item yet.
The seller intends to refund my money and repost the the item. I need the item and still want the item.
Can the seller cancel and refund the money, even though the package is still in transit back to the seller or a return delivery to the sellers address?
Are there any steps I can take to ensure the seller can't change his mind and require him to mail the package I purchased?
The seller and I have had pleasant emails back and forth but I am informed the he plans to refund my money after a specific date. If I want the item, I will have to go to auction process again.
Any help you all can provide would be much appreciated.

No the seller does not have to reship to you. Ebay only requires a refund if the seller was wrong. If the item is relisted then perhaps you can purchase it again..making sure the address you provide when you pay is correct.
